Observability Tools and Platforms Market Revenue and Trends 2026 to 2035

The global observability tools and platforms market revenue reached USD 11.80 billion in 2025 and is predicted to attain around USD 49.60 billion by 2035 with a CAGR of 15.44%. The market for observability tools and platforms is growing as organizations seek to navigate complex cloud, AI, and distributed infrastructures. Even minor outages, visibility gaps, performance slowdowns, or system issues are quickly noticed by these platforms.

Market at a Glance

Observability tools and platforms provide the enterprise with higher visibility into the health, performance, and behaviors of an entire system. These platforms collect and analyze telemetry data, including logs, metrics, traces, and events, to detect anomalies, troubleshoot issues, and optimize system performance more effectively.

The market spans solutions deployed across cloud-native, on-premises, and hybrid environments, along with associated services. It includes capabilities such as application performance monitoring, infrastructure visibility, cloud performance management, network diagnostics, user experience monitoring, and incident response automation. These tools are widely used by both large enterprises and SMEs across industries such as banking, healthcare, retail, manufacturing, and telecommunications, where maintaining digital reliability is critical to business continuity.

What Influences the Observability Tools and Platforms Market?

  • AI Monitoring Complexity Creates Demand: The increasing adoption of AI workloads is adding complexity to IT environments. According to industry insights, a significant number of organizations report challenges in monitoring AI systems. This creates strong demand for advanced observability platforms that offer capabilities such as model tracing, inference monitoring, and automated root-cause analysis.
  • Demand for Managed Observability: Mid-sized organizations often lack dedicated site reliability engineering (SRE) teams while operating complex cloud-native infrastructures. This gap is driving demand for managed observability solutions that offer turnkey deployment, automated alerting, and usage-based pricing models. Vendors targeting this segment are well-positioned to capture significant growth opportunities in the coming years.

Market Segmentation Overview

  • By component, the software segment dominated the observability tools and platforms market with a 78% share in 2025 and is expected to maintain its leading position in the coming years, as enterprises leaned heavily on core observability platforms. Companies prefer software that reduces operational blind spots and improves infrastructure decision-making.
  • By deployment mode, the cloud-based segment dominated the market with a 70% share in 2025 and is expected to maintain its leading position in the coming years because of the rapid adoption of SaaS solutions. Also, cloud-based platforms are favored for their enhanced ability to scale within growing digital environments.
  • By technology, the AI  & ML-based observability segment dominated the market with a 28% share in 2025 and is expected to maintain its leading position in the coming years because of its intelligent monitoring capabilities. Its ability to automate pattern recognition and predictive alerting makes it highly effective in managing complex, data-intensive systems.
  • By application, the IT operations management segment accounted for a considerable revenue share of 30% in the observability tools and platforms market in 2025, driven by its essential role in monitoring infrastructure, ensuring service continuity, and supporting incident response and resource optimization.
  • By application, the DevOps and CI/CD monitoring segment is expected to expand rapidly in the market with a CAGR of 21.5% in the coming years, due to the adoption of agile development practices and continuous delivery models requiring real-time visibility across development pipelines.
  • By end-use industry, the IT & telecom segment dominated the observability tools and platforms market with a 35.0% market share in 2025 and is expected to maintain its leading position in the coming years. This is mainly due to the high adoption of observability platforms in this sector to manage dense digital ecosystems. High demand for uptime, increasing network complexity, and rising customer expectations continue to drive investment in observability solutions.

Regional Analysis

North America dominated the global observability tools and platforms market with a major share of 42.0% in 2025. The region’s dominance is driven by widespread adoption of cloud-native technologies such as containers, Kubernetes, microservices, and hybrid cloud architectures. The U.S. remains the dominant contributor due to a high concentration of hyperscalers and SaaS providers. Canada witnessed strong growth due to high adoption across banking, telecommunications, and government sectors.

Asia Pacific held a market share of 20% in 2025 and is expected to grow at the fastest CAGR of 22.5% during the forecast period. This growth is fueled by rapid IT modernization, increasing cloud adoption, and the expansion of digital ecosystems. China is advancing through large-scale digitization and smart infrastructure initiatives. Moreover, India is experiencing strong growth driven by its expanding IT services sector, startup ecosystem, and cloud-first strategies.

Top Companies in the Observability Tools and Platforms Market

Datadog, Splunk, New Relic, and Dynatrace have established strong market positions by offering full-stack observability solutions, real-time telemetry insights, and AI-driven troubleshooting capabilities. In contrast, Elastic and Grafana Labs maintain competitive strength through open-source-driven approaches, attracting engineering-focused organizations seeking flexibility, customization, and cost efficiency.

At the same time, major technology providers such as Cisco Systems, IBM, Microsoft, Google Cloud, Amazon Web Services (AWS), and Oracle are increasingly integrating observability into their broader portfolios, including cloud computing, networking, cybersecurity, and infrastructure services. Additionally, VMware, ServiceNow, and BMC Software play a key role in supporting hybrid IT environments, workflow automation, and legacy system management, where comprehensive operational visibility is essential.
